一,什么是版本控制?
版本控制是指对软件开发过程中各种程序代码、配置文件及说明文档等文件变更的管理,是软件配置管理的核心思想之一。
在进行项目开发过程中,你是否会有下面的经历?
当客户需求改变时,需要重新对项目进行修改。又怕将来客户撤销这个需求怎么办?只能把原来没修改的和已经修改的项目都保存下来。随着客户需求的变更,你需要备份多个项目。最后你的项目就变成了上面的那样。看着一堆乱七八糟的项目,想保留最新的一个,然后把其他的删掉,又怕哪天会用上,还不敢删,真郁闷。
如果有一个版本控制工具,来帮助我们记录每一次项目的变更,像下面这样,岂不是很方便?
这就有必要来学习一下Git版本控制工具,它就像上面那样,很好地帮助我们解决了手动管理多个项目“版本”问题。
二,Git版本控制工具的简单使用
1.什么是Git?
1.1 Git是一个免费的开源 分布式版本控制系统,旨在快速,高效地处理从小型到大型项目的所有事务。
1.2 2008年Github上线,为开源项目免费提供Git存储。
2.Git下载安装
下载网址:https://git-scm.com/downloads
根据自己电脑的系统选择对应的版本,我选择的是windows版本。
根据操作系统选择Git的版本,我选择的是64位的Git版本,点击下载。
找到下载Git应用程序,双击进行安装。
在cmd窗口中,使用git --version命令查看Git是否安装成功